What Are Local Services Ads for Law Firms?

Local Services Ads are a pay-per-lead advertising format offered directly by Google. Unlike traditional pay-per-click (PPC) ads, LSA charges you only when a verified lead contacts your firm. Additionally, LSA listings display a “Google Screened” badge, which signals trust and credibility to potential clients immediately.

For law firms, this is a significant advantage. Clients searching for an attorney are already in a high-intent mindset. They need help now. Because of this, appearing at the very top of the results page — with a verified badge — dramatically increases the likelihood they will call your office.

How LSA Differs from Standard PPC Advertising

Standard Google Ads charge you per click, whether or not that click results in a real lead. LSA, however, charges you only when a potential client calls or messages your firm directly through the ad. Furthermore, Google pre-screens businesses that run LSA, so your firm earns that trusted “Google Screened” badge automatically.

This means your marketing budget works more efficiently. You pay for actual lead opportunities, not just traffic. For law firms managing tight acquisition costs, this distinction matters enormously.

How to Get the Most from Your LSA Campaign in Philadelphia

Simply activating an LSA account is not enough. To generate a consistent flow of qualified leads, Philadelphia law firms need to actively optimize their campaigns. First, your Google Business Profile must be complete, accurate, and filled with strong client reviews. LSA pulls directly from this profile, so a weak or incomplete listing will hurt your performance.

Next, you need to select the right practice area categories within your LSA setup. Google uses these categories to match your ads to relevant searches. Choosing the wrong categories means showing up for searches that do not convert, which wastes budget and lowers your overall campaign efficiency.

Managing Leads and Disputing Invalid Contacts

One of the most underutilized features of LSA is lead dispute management. If you receive a call that is clearly not a qualified lead — a wrong number, a spam call, or an out-of-area inquiry — you can dispute that charge directly within the LSA dashboard. However, many firms miss this step and overpay as a result.

What does LSA stand for in legal marketing?

LSA stands for Local Services Ads. These are Google-managed advertisements that appear at the very top of search results. Law firms pay per verified lead rather than per click, making LSA a cost-efficient option for legal client acquisition.

How does lsa Philadelphia help law firms get more clients?

LSA Philadelphia places your law firm at the top of Google search results when potential clients search for legal help in the area. The Google Screened badge builds instant credibility. Because of this, high-intent searchers are more likely to call your firm directly from the ad.

Do I need a Google Business Profile to run LSA?

Yes. A complete and verified Google Business Profile is required to run Local Services Ads. Google pulls your firm’s information, reviews, and ratings directly from this profile to populate your LSA listing. Therefore, keeping your profile updated is essential for strong LSA performance.

How much does LSA cost for Philadelphia law firms?

LSA pricing is based on a cost-per-lead model. Costs vary depending on your practice area and local competition. Legal categories tend to have higher lead costs than other industries. However, because you only pay for actual leads, the return on investment can be significantly better than traditional PPC campaigns.
